I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Python Discussion :

requêts SQL avec python 2.7 [Python 2.X]


Sujet :

Python

  1. #1
    Membre confirmé
    Femme Profil pro
    étudiant master
    Inscrit en
    Février 2014
    Messages
    167
    Détails du profil
    Informations personnelles :
    Sexe : Femme
    Localisation : Algérie

    Informations professionnelles :
    Activité : étudiant master

    Informations forums :
    Inscription : Février 2014
    Messages : 167
    Par défaut requêts SQL avec python 2.7
    bonjour

    j'ai un souci dans l'exécution d'un code python contient une requête SQL (au dessous), le souci c'est que le code fait la somme de production de toutes les communes sauf une commune, et cela seulement pour un type de céréales (orge).
    vraiment je me suis bloqué et je ne sais pas où se trouve le problème? surtout que je suis pressée et je doit présenté mon travail bientot

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    import arcpy
     
    BD_SIGMSA4 ="Database Servers\mon_PC_SQLEXPRESS.gds\hhh (VERSION:dbo.DEFAULT)"
     
    req4="Select CodeCommuneFK as codecom,SUM(ISNULL(Production,0)) As [ProdTotal2],SUM(ISNULL(Rendement, 0)) As [RendTotal2],SUM(Superficie) As [SupTotal2],TypeCereales  FROM hhh.DBO.CerealesHiver  Where TypeCereales='3' AND AnneeAgricole='12' and CodeCommuneFK='2728' GROUP BY CodeCommuneFK,TypeCereales"
    arcpy.CreateDatabaseView_management(BD_SIGMSA4, "ddd11", req4)


    merci

  2. #2
    Expert éminent
    Homme Profil pro
    Architecte technique retraité
    Inscrit en
    Juin 2008
    Messages
    21 707
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Manche (Basse Normandie)

    Informations professionnelles :
    Activité : Architecte technique retraité
    Secteur : Industrie

    Informations forums :
    Inscription : Juin 2008
    Messages : 21 707
    Par défaut
    Salut,

    Si votre requête SQL ne retourne pas ce que vous attendez, c'est qu'elle est mal construite ou que certaines colonnes ne sont pas bien remplies.
    Vous ne mentionnez pas le serveur de base de données utilisé.
    Normalement, vous devez avoir une interface d'administration permettant de tester vos requêtes SQL hors contexte de votre application.
    Si vous reproduisez le problème dans cet environnement là, le plus simple sera de poster votre requête/question dans le forum SGDB ad hoc.
    D'ici là, regarder la chose côté "programmation Python" n'apportera pas grand chose.

    - W
    Architectures post-modernes.
    Python sur DVP c'est aussi des FAQs, des cours et tutoriels

  3. #3
    Membre confirmé
    Femme Profil pro
    étudiant master
    Inscrit en
    Février 2014
    Messages
    167
    Détails du profil
    Informations personnelles :
    Sexe : Femme
    Localisation : Algérie

    Informations professionnelles :
    Activité : étudiant master

    Informations forums :
    Inscription : Février 2014
    Messages : 167
    Par défaut
    apparemment le problème était dans les valeurs , j'ai remplacé la table par une nouvelle et tout fonctionne bien.

    merci pour votre réponse.

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Requête sql avec Python
    Par melwin dans le forum SQLite
    Réponses: 3
    Dernier message: 03/02/2014, 19h55
  2. Requête SQL avec une réponse unique
    Par Glutinus dans le forum Langage SQL
    Réponses: 5
    Dernier message: 06/07/2005, 16h35
  3. Problème de requête SQL avec instruction TRANSFORM
    Par Nosper dans le forum Requêtes et SQL.
    Réponses: 4
    Dernier message: 21/06/2005, 16h15
  4. requête SQL avec paramètre en vb avec base de donnée SQL srv
    Par dialydany dans le forum VB 6 et antérieur
    Réponses: 5
    Dernier message: 01/02/2005, 10h33
  5. PB requète SQL avec Interbase
    Par missllyss dans le forum InterBase
    Réponses: 2
    Dernier message: 15/07/2003, 11h37

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o